Summary:
Have you ever wondered how birds know when to fly south for the winter? This introduction to bird behavior explores how and why woodpeckers peck, how pelicans fly without flapping their wings, why birds sing, and more. The How Do series is a great introduction to various STEM topics, each written in a format that encourages audiences to ask questions and guess the answers before exploring the science behind them.
